#6
@MatHayward, please let us have an option do withdraw USD to a bank account directly!
If it's too much hustle for small amounts, limit bank withdrawal to 2-5-10k$ or whatever amount you find reasonable.

PayPal is taking too much of a fee for conversion USD to my local currency (and no option to withdraw USD).
I'm losing minimum 60$ to PayPal each month, which is 720$ a year only for currency conversion!
#7
Meta and Shutterstock will expand their business partnership, allowing the social media company to train its artificial intelligence and machine learning systems on Shutterstock's collection of millions of images.

The two companies have announced what they categorize as a "significant partnership," with the goal of bringing Meta's artificial intelligence (AI) innovation to the forefront using the power of Shutterstock's massive content library.

#9
I strongly agree with stoker2014 about Shutterstock decline. I sell only photos, for 12 years now, my portfolio constantly growing. But everything changed in Jan 2021 - since then my income on SS was cut 2-3 times, and continues to sharply decline every month. Not only majority of subscriptions are now 0.10, but enhanced licenses became very-very rare, and also i have 4x less on-demand downloads compared to 2020.

#13
Quote from: MatHayward on June 25, 2020, 16:23I always appreciate the feedback and suggestions.

MatHayward, please-please-please, remake current system of choosing 5 most important keywords!
Scrolling through the list to find keyword, then jump to top, then scroll again, jump, scroll - it's is absolute nightmare for user. At least make so whole keyword list don't jump to top, when sending one keyword to top!
BTW Alamy have great system where you see all keywords at once and just click on word and it's highlighted and added to important keyword. Please save contributors from infinite scrolling!
